EXDIGIT drives Down Under!
Cansu Demir, doctoral candidate in Human-Computer Interaction, represented the University of Salzburg at the 17th International Conference on Automotive User Interfaces and Interactive Vehicular Applications (AutomotiveUI 2025). The conference was hosted by Queensland University of Technology (QUT) in Brisbane, Australia.
Her contributions to the conference program included a presentation in the doctoral colloquium, two poster pitches, and service as a student volunteer. The doctoral colloquium provided an important platform to discuss her dissertation project with leading experts in the field including industry and academia, while the poster sessions enabled a broader dissemination of her ongoing research.
AutomotiveUI is the premier international venue for Human-Computer Interaction research in the automotive domain.
